If I were ever to vacation here, I would make it a long two week vacation.  Hotel Eden Roc at Cap Cana is where I would definitely stay.  To stay in a suite with a king size bed, private infinite pool, and lounge bed on the patio would cost $1,126.40 for two weeks.  The resort has its own classy restaurants, La Cava, Mediterraneo Restaurant, Gastronomico Restaurant, Blue Lagoon Pool Bar, La Palapa.  It even has its own spa, Solaya Spa.  They use native healing philosophies, and contemporary technologies to soothe, nurture, and energize your body.  Flying out of Logan Airport in Boston, Massachusetts on a direct flight to Punta Cana International would take seven hours and eighteen minutes, costing $912.50.  It would definitely be a costly vacation, which I, or anyone else interested in this vacation, would have to save up for quite awhile but it would be worth it.
